Chicago Metropolitan Chapter of ASPMN
The purpose of the Chicago Metropolitan Chapter of the American Society for Pain Management Nursing shall be to unite through educational endeavors professional registered nurses dedicated to the promotion of the highest standards of care for all patients experiencing pain throughout their lifespan.
